About Me:
Rodrigo Ontaneda: an insurance businessman by training & conservation practitioner & eco-entrepreneur, who founded the Maquipucuna Foundation in Ecuador back in 1988, and came up with the idea of establishing a roasting business abroad, starting in the USA in 2004, as a mechanism for marketing our SHG arabica coffee growing in our own land of Orongo, Pichincha province, since 1999. Besides the same type of coffee we promoted along the rainforests Andean mountains of northern and southern Ecuador, south America, since the 90's.
About My Company:
1000 Faces Coffee is a wonderfully beautiful micro-roaster based in Athens, Georgia. I/We source as directly from farmers as anyone in the world. I am actually coffee grower, born and raised in Ecuador, south America. In 2010, 1000 Faces Coffee was selected as one of three finalists for Roaster of the Year by Roast Magazine and won "2009 Runner up - Micro Coffee Roaster of the Year". Our main coffee sourcing Cafe Choco Andes has been Featured by The World Institute of Slowness as "The Slow-Production-Coffee' World-Model".
